Inter have confirmed Scudetto’s credentials by beating Juventus, claims Vidal

Antonio Conte believes the champions still have an edge over the rest of Serie A, but his midfielder believes Milan’s club are real competitors.

Inter have confirmed what they are taking to sustain a major title challenge this season by beating the reigning Juventus champions 2-0, according to Arturo Vidal.

Vidal opened the scoring against his former club at San Siro on Sunday, going home with a cross from Nicolo Barella to find the net in Serie A for the first time since the goal hit his Scudetto for Juve in May 2015.

Juve was the first player to score for Inter in the Derby d’Italia from Christian Vieri in 2004 and the eighth player to score for both sides in the game.

Lautaro Martinez and Romelu Lukaku missed chances to add to the Inter stage but Barella made no mistake with an emphatic finish in the 52nd minute.

As a result, the Nerazzurri have claimed their first league title against Juve since September 2016 and their first with a clean sheet since April 2010.

Antonio Conte’s side moved level with Serie A Milan leaders on 40 points and opened a seven-point advantage over the reigning champions.

Milan can back up their three-point lead by beating Cagliari in their game in their hands on Inter on Monday, but Vidal doesn’t think Conte’s men are going to fall.

“It’s important for me and the team. It was a very tough game against the best team in Italy,” Vidal said. Sky Italia Sports. “I’m glad I got my first goal for Inter, very happy. I think we’ve proven that we’re up to the act of fighting for the Scudetto.

“This will give us the confidence to keep pushing, to believe that we can win the Scudetto, because we have beaten the strongest team over the last nine years. We believe we can to go all the way. “

Conte forced Juve to start just three Serie A titles to start their reign and finally got their first league victory on them in the fourth attempt.

Despite Inter emerging and Juve seven points ahead, Conte still believes the Bianconeri are the winning team in the race for the title.

“To beat a team like Juventus, which is for every Italian club as a point of information, we have to put in a good performance. We did that,” Conte said.

“We prepared well and it is gratifying to see that we were right about what we thought could hurt Juventus. The lads followed the plan perfectly and I am very happy with it. because these are games that need to give you self-belief, let you understand that you are on the right track.

“We saw the results of this process last season and we continue to see them this term. Juventus were an important point of reference, a side that controlled Serie A for nine years, after an outstanding work. do both on the field and as a club.

“I still maintain that Juve has a gap not just from Inter, but all other clubs, but we are working to close the gap.”
